How to enable scripting in your browser
This Web site uses scripting to enhance your browsing
experience.
To allow all Web sites in the Internet zone to run scripts, use the
steps that apply to your browser:
Windows Internet Explorer
(all versions except
Pocket Internet Explorer)
Note To allow scripting on this Web site only, and to
leave scripting disabled in the Internet zone,
add this Web site to
the Trusted sites zone.
- On the Tools menu, click Internet
Options, and then click the Security tab.
- Click the Internet zone.
- If you do not have to customize your Internet security settings,
click Default Level. Then do step 4
If you have to customize your Internet security settings, follow
these steps:
a. Click Custom Level.
b. In the Security Settings – Internet Zone
dialog box, click Enable for Active
Scripting in the Scripting section.
- Click the Back button to return to the previous
page, and then click the Refresh button to run
scripts.
Mozilla Corporation’s Firefox version 2
- On the Tools menu, click Options.
- On the Content tab, click to select the
Enable JavaScript check box.
- Click the Go back one page button to return to
the previous page, and then click the Reload current page
button to run scripts.
Google Chrome
- On the Tools menu, click Options.
- Click Under the Hood tab then Content
Settings button.
- Click to select the Enable JavaScript check
box, and then click Close.
Opera Software’s Opera version 9
- On the Tools menu, click Preferences.
- On the Advanced tab, click Content.
- Click the Allow all sites to run JavaScript
radio button .then click OK.
- Click the Back button to return to the previous
page, and then click the Reload button to run
scripts.
Netscape browsers
- Select Edit, Preferences,Advanced
- Click to select Enable JavaScript option.
